    Payne heat pump blowing fuse.
    I have a Payne Heat Pump which blows the 5 amp fuse in the heat cycle. Sometimes it will run for a couple hours before it blows. Any ideas?

    Check for a low voltage short on the defrost thermostat. It only has 24v on each wire after the switch closes from cold temp. You may have a wire rubbing on a copper line inside the system. Turn power of to the system and inspect for any low voltage wire short.
